Output 50babaffb85b5354351aeab46affc72983c4e255a5fc9ff8672b04aa8b9cd80a:2

value
33430278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f505599d978a06f8a5b84ca88bed5c270f579af2 OP_EQUAL
address
3Q2ZtGfkMdj2Bw4bjymxhxjqvqPXikuRoB
transaction
50babaffb85b5354351aeab46affc72983c4e255a5fc9ff8672b04aa8b9cd80a
confirmations
451690
spent
true